Dad jokes+coffee= a good time.
Revisado: 08-21-19
This novel had me laughing for a hours, reading it straight in one sitting. The audible addition made it even better, as I was able to finish it in the same day.
Presenting us a young man without much of a direction in life as the main character, it subverts the system (gameLit) genre plagued by forced deus ex-Machinas without any fear of making fun of itself.
There was great attention to details in the crafts it spoke about (coffee), and a great cast of lovely and relatable characters.
Overall, it's well worth a listen for the low price of a coffee.

Slow start, good developments.
Revisado: 06-14-19
Fate is not the average litrpg in the sense that it is not a power fest. It's a much more casual approach to a VRMMO, with friends learning together about the unknowns of a newly released game.
In that sense, this book works as an introduction to a much vaster world — one with its own lore, beliefs, and a very well crafted magic system.
I'll be waiting for the next installment in its audiobook form.
